How to Replace Cartridge(s)
- Make sure the printer is turned off. See to it that the power and communications cables are unplugged.
- Lift the printer off of the optional tray if installed.
- Open the top door.
- Hold the used cartridge in the middle and lift it straight up to take it out of the printer.
- Unbox the new toner cartridge.
- Remove the new cartridge from its packaging and gently shake it from side to side to distribute the toner evenly.
- Carefully pull the plastic pull tab at the end of the cartridge to remove the entire length of the protective tape.
- Slide the new cartridge into the printer.
- Close the top door.

Why am I getting printouts that are lighter than usual after installing a new toner cartridge?
Lighter printouts could be due to the activated EconoMode setting on your printer control panel. You can
turn this toner-saving feature off by unchecking the checkbox on the Print Quality tab settings.
How do I store a new ink cartridge?
Do not remove the new ink cartridge from the packaging until you are ready to install it on your HP Laserjet 2300d. Keep it away from direct sunlight—store it only in a cool, dry place.
How would I know when the cartridge is low on toner?
When the cartridge is low on toner, the ORDER CARTRIDGE message appears on the printer control panel.
